- Wideband, compact, Dual Carrier LN Modulator for next generation 400G optical networks -
Kawasaki, Japan, February 1, 2016 - Fujitsu Optical Components Limited (FOC) announced today that on February, 2016 it will be releasing the world’s first Dual Carrier (*1) LN (*2) Modulator supporting 200G DP-QPSK (*3) and 400G DP-xQAM (*4) modulation formats for beyond 100G optical networks. Twice the transmission capacity of conventional LN modulators is achieved by integrating two compact sized DP-QPSK Mach-Zehnder modulators into one package. This product will help facilitate compact, high performance, low power consumption optical network equipment for 200G/400G optical networks.

Internet services such as cloud computing have led to a rapid increase in the volume of communications traffic. The arrival of the IoT (Internet of Things) age will further accelerate the volume of communications traffic in the future. This has led to the spread of 100G optical networks and increased demand for next-generation beyond 100G optical networks The requirement for core and metro networks to handle larger capacity and longer distance on their links has resulted in the expansion of 100G optical networks using digital coherent transmission systems (*5). R&D activities related to the commercialization of next-generation beyond 100G optical networks has also gained significant momentum. On the transmission side of these coherent optical transceivers high performance LN modulators supporting both 200G DP-QPSK and 400G DP-xQAM modulation format are required.
FOC has successfully commercialized the world’s first Dual Carrier LN Modulator supporting 200G DP-QPSK and 400G DP-xQAM modulation formats for beyond 100G optical networks. This product integrates 2 DP-QPSK Mach-Zehnder modulators into 1 compact package to achieve twice the transmission capacity of conventional LN modulators. This product will help facilitate compact, high performance, low power consumption optical network equipment for 200G/400G optical networks.
Key Features
-
Twice the transmission capacity of conventional LN modulators while maintaining a compact size A new process technology which improves the modulation efficiency of the LN modulator chip, and a wideband G3PO RF interface instead of the GPPO RF interfaces used in conventional 100G DP-QPSK modulators keep the package compact while achieving doubled transmission capacity over standard LN modulators.
-
200G DP-QPSK and 400G DP-xQAM modulation format support The Dual Carrier LN Modulator integrates 2 DP-QPSK LN modulators onto 1 chip and 2 polarization beam couplers into 1 compact package to provide support for both 200G DP-QPSK and 400G DP-xQAM modulation formats.
